Message: MetaWorks Accelerates Expansion into Waste-to-Energy with Strategic Acquisition of FogDog Energy

Innovative tech company to launch new operations by Q4, targeting significant growth in the renewable energy sector

In a move that signals its commitment to advancing sustainable energy solutions, MetaWorks Platforms, Inc. (OTCQB: MWRK), a technology-focused firm with a reputation for leveraging cutting-edge innovations, has announced the acquisition of assets from FogDog Energy Solutions, Inc. (FDE). This strategic acquisition, which effectively resolves MetaWorks' outstanding debt with FDE, is poised to accelerate the company's entry into the burgeoning waste-to-energy market through its subsidiary, EnergyWorks Corp. The deal comes as MetaWorks gears up to commence revenue-generating operations by the fourth quarter of this year.

The waste-to-energy process involves converting non-recyclable waste materials into usable forms of energy, such as electricity, heat, or fuel, thereby reducing landfill waste and greenhouse gas emissions. With global plastic consumption having quadrupled over the past 30 years and only about 9% of plastic waste being recycled, according to a report by the OECD, the need for sustainable waste management solutions has never been more urgent. Key Highlights and Advantages: A Strategic Move with High Potential

MetaWorks’ acquisition of FogDog Energy’s assets is a decisive step towards capitalizing on the rapidly growing waste-to-energy market. This transaction includes several key components that are expected to drive MetaWorks' success in this new venture:

  • Debt Exchange: The acquisition enables MetaWorks to exchange its debt with FogDog Energy in full, thereby strengthening its financial position.
  • MOU with Oklahoma Municipality: The deal includes a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with an Oklahoma municipality, providing a foundational partnership for the company’s waste-to-energy operations.
  • Fast-Tracking Operations: With this acquisition, MetaWorks is on track to begin revenue-generating operations by the fourth quarter of 2024, significantly ahead of many industry peers.
  • Business Development Agreement: MetaWorks will collaborate with the FDE team under a new business development agreement, focusing on scaling the waste-to-energy business and expanding into additional locations in 2025.
